>> hmm... why is there an icon and plist in the macos folder?
> those are leftovers from previous fluxus versions. the app bundle won't
> work on different computers, because the application is not statically
> compiled, the mzscheme framework is not included in the app, and the
> scheme scripts must be on the plt scheme collect path. hopefully we will
> fix these issues in the future and making an app bundle will be possible.

Another option is to make fluxus a plt planet package.
